No reason, just wanted to make sure you weren’t avoiding 16bit stuff because it is lower than CD quality. I’ve had quite a few times where the flacs that a band puts on bandcamp are higher than CD quality, which I guess is appreciated by some. The problem is bandcamp doesn’t tell you what quality the flacs are, just that they are flac, so I always end up downsampling them to 16/44.1 anyway since sonos won’t play any higher.
